Problem
Existing data transmission methods between two application clients in a mobile device require multiple complex steps, making the operation cumbersome.
Innovation Solution
A data transmission method that establishes a communication connection between source and target clients using a communication unit, allowing data transfer by dragging thumbnails, with conditions such as long press duration or drag instructions triggering the transfer.

Embodiments of the present application disclose a data transmission method and apparatus which are to be applied to a source client, wherein the source client is a client in a foreground running status in a mobile terminal, the mobile terminal, by means of a split-screen function, divides the display screen thereof into a first split screen for displaying a running interface of the source client and a second split screen for displaying a running interface of a target client, the target client is a client in a foreground running status in the mobile terminal. The method comprises: establishing a communication connection between the source client and the target client; receiving a drag instruction for a thumbnail of target data in the source client and moving the thumbnail according to the drag instruction; monitoring whether a data transmission instruction for the target data is received, if yes, transmitting the target data to the target client through the established communication connection. By applying the embodiments of the present application, users can make full advantage of the split-screen technology, which simplifies data transmission operation.
